A Crystal Age

Author: Hudson, W. H. (William Henry)

Synopsis:


In 'A Crystal Age' by W. H. Hudson, the protagonist stumbles upon a hidden world that is seemingly untouched by time. As he explores this mysterious realm, he encounters a society that has achieved a state of perfect harmony with nature and technology. However, as he delves deeper into this utopian civilization, he begins to question the cost of such perfection and the true nature of humanity. This thought-provoking tale takes readers on a captivating journey through a world that challenges our understanding of progress and the pursuit of an ideal society.
